            Senator Trump moved to amend the bill on page two, section two, lines six through twelve by striking out the following: The Commissioner of Labor in office on the effective date of this section shall, unless sooner removed, continue to serve until his or her term expires and his or her successor has been appointed and has qualified. On or before April 1, 1941, and on or before April 1 of each fourth year thereafter, the Governor shall appoint a Commissioner of Labor to serve for a term of four years, commencing on April 1.
